Yacht Description

Two Oceans Marine’s 77-foot (23.5-meter) SAMELI, a balance 760 model, is a fly-bridge catamaran designed for exceptional sailing performance. She can travel twice as fast as competing models while also providing an unprecedented level of comfort and style for a charter experience you’ll never forget.

SAMELI is one of the few yachts of her sort capable of providing a fast, sporty, and luxury sailing experience due to her ultra-lightweight construction and design for high-speed world voyaging. It is possible to sail at 13–15 knots when the wind is just 15 mph, and she has reached speeds of up to 25 knots while under sail, making her an extreme luxury performer.

Her exterior was designed by Anton Du Toit, winner of a number of catamaran design awards, and she was built using only the highest quality materials. Her upcoming refit in early 2023 will introduce a tranquil new atmosphere based on the minimalist design by renowned architect and yacht designer Apostolos Molindris.

SAMELI’s key features go above and beyond those of an ultra-luxury catamaran; her minimalist interior design will create a relaxing vibe in her stylish open-plan saloon and high-spec chef’s galley, which are both outfitted in warm tones of natural wood and bathed in light from the yacht’s panoramic windows. With her five luxurious cabins, she can comfortably seat up to 10 passengers who may gaze out the ship’s one-of-a-kind, sea-level windows.

Spacious outdoor decks make it simple to host gatherings and barbecues with friends and family. A BBQ pit installed in the cockpit makes eating outside a pleasurable experience. You can spend the day fishing and then enjoy your catch for dinner that night. She also features a large flybridge where you can enjoy a meal while taking in the panoramic views.

SAMELI is a fuel-efficient powerboat, making her the perfect expedition catamaran for individuals who value comfort while exploring distant lands. SAMELI is a great charter yacht for small parties of up to six people because of her spacious interior, efficient engines, and emphasis on fun and relaxation for her passengers.
